This isn’t really a “true” popup, but just a Y growth.

In the example shown, I used PLA.
The middle cube divided in two … outer cubes not divided.
Starting with the last frame … full height …select all top points.
At frame 60, click on record. Move to frame 40 and move those
points down … fully squished cubes … and record.
Now at frame 20, select all left points and rotate axis making sure
to move axis along the X and Y … and record at mid bend stage.
Finally, at frame 0, rotate points to folded position and record.
